We have a right to know about abuse funds

YOUR newspaper is to be congratulated for being the only major media outlet in the nation to cover the funding of groups which have received funding for institutional abuse.
We have a right to know about abuse funds

A year ago I called for an audit of all groups that have received such funding. On 6 December, 2010, your journalist Conall ÓFatharta reported that ”...the likely cost of the redress scheme for victims of abuse in residential institutions is now put at €1.1 billion” and that ”...the report (from The Comptroller and Auditor General) highlighted that the further funding of one group in particular was being examined.”

The Irish people have a right to know who got what, why they got it, and how much they got. Government has an obligation to release such information to the Irish people and groups which have supported institutional abuse must release how much funds each has received.
